Convolution filters for polygons and the Petr-Douglas-Neumann theorem
Nicollier, Grégoire
In: Beiträge zur Algebra und Geometrie / Contributions to Algebra and Geometry, 2013, vol. 54, no. 2, p. 701-708

- We use the discrete Fourier transformation of planar polygons, convolution filters, and a shape function to give a very simple and enlightening description of circulant polygon transformations and their iterates. We consider in particular Napoleon's and the Petr-Douglas-Neumann theorem
